Atlassian Plans 1,600 Job Cuts Amid AI-Driven Strategy Shift

Atlassian is set to lay off approximately 1,600 employees as part of its strategic pivot to artificial intelligence and enterprise sales. This move reflects a broader industry trend where tech companies are reallocating resources to AI capabilities to foster growth.
